📜  不使用第一行作为索引熊猫 - Python (1)

📅  最后修改于: 2023-12-03 14:48:49.573000             🧑  作者: Mango

不使用第一行作为索引熊猫 - Python

在使用 Pandas 进行数据分析时,我们通常会使用 Pandas 的 DataFrame 对象来处理和操作数据。默认情况下,Pandas 会将数据的第一行作为索引,即行标签。然而,在某些情况下,我们可能要根据自己的需求来指定索引而不使用第一行作为索引。

设置自定义索引

首先,我们需要导入 Pandas 库并加载数据到 DataFrame 中:

import pandas as pd

data = pd.read_csv('data.csv')

然后,我们可以通过指定 index_col 参数来设置自定义的索引列。这个参数接受一个整数值或列名作为参数,用来指定哪一列作为索引。以下是两个示例:

  • 使用第一列(索引列号为0)作为索引:
data = pd.read_csv('data.csv', index_col=0)
  • 使用名为 'id' 的列作为索引:
data = pd.read_csv('data.csv', index_col='id')
重置索引

如果已经设置了自定义索引,并且希望将索引重置为默认的整数索引,可以使用 reset_index 方法。以下是使用示例:

data = data.reset_index()

如果你希望在重置索引的同时删除原来的索引列,可以传递参数 drop=True

data = data.reset_index(drop=True)
结论

通过本文,你学会了如何在 Pandas 中不使用第一行作为索引,并且还学会了如何设置自定义索引和重置索引。这将帮助你更好地掌握 Pandas 库并进行数据分析。

以上就是关于"不使用第一行作为索引熊猫 - Python"的介绍,希望对你有所帮助!如果您有任何疑问,请随时提问。